Turin: Egyptian Museum Monolingual Skip-the-Line Guided Mystery Tour,Small group
5
Meet our licensed guide in Piazza Carignano and enter the beautiful Egyptian museum with a skip-the-line ticket.
Explore the exhibitions dedicated exclusively to ancient Egyptian culture and art. Take a journey through time as the displays show items in chronological order, from the 4th-century BC to the 3rd-century AD.
Together with your guide, discover the mysterious and magical side of the Egyptian Empire on this gripping tour.
See the spectacular Tomb of Kha, a tomb builder to the pharaohs, which dates back to 3,500 BC.
Admire the sarcophagi, statues, sundries, and furniture, as well as astonishingly well-preserved items such as salted meat and a pottery bowl with the remains of tamarind and grapes.
Next, head to the Drovetti Collection of papyrus sheets, which is considered by some as the most important in the world. Finally, visit the Ellesija Temple, a rock-hewn temple which is more than 3,500-years-old.

Egyptian Museum Private Tour - Skip-the-Line
1
Meet your guide at Piazza Carignano and then skip the long lines to enter Turin's Egyptian Museum. Pick-up from your hotel is possible if it is centrally located, but note that you will then walk to the museum.
The Egyptian Museum in Turin is the most important of its kind in the world after the one in Cairo. Home to over 30,000 artifacts that narrate 5,000 years of Ancient Egyptian history, the collection includes art, religious relics and items from everyday life during the time of the great pharaohs.
